
ISDPA Mission Statement
The ISDPA is organized to promote the professional and personal development of Physician Assistants in the State of Illinois in the practice of quality, cost effective, and accessible health care in the medical specialty of dermatology. The ISPDA will also promote the Physician/PA relationship of the health care team in the practice of patient centered medical care.
Objectives for the ISDPA
-
Establish and maintain a representative organization and forum for physician assistants who practice, or have an interest in the medical specialty of dermatology.
-
Develop, sponsor and evaluate continuing medical or medically related education programs for the physician assistant.
-
Serve as a public information center and educate the medical community, health professionals and the public regarding physician assistants in dermatology.
-
Promote the academic and clinical training of physician assistants in dermatology.
-
Serve as a scientific, research and educational resource for its members and other health care professionals.
-
Assist in the development of published articles in appropriate professional journals, of topics in dermatology.
-
Participate in the development of academic and clinical training programs of physician assistants.
